Man City and Premier League Settle APT Rules Dispute, Ending Arbitration

The agreement comes after a tribunal voided earlier rules, prompting a league rewrite.

Overview

  • Manchester City has accepted the current Associated Party Transaction rules as valid and binding.
  • The October arbitration hearing has been canceled, and both parties say they will make no further comment.
  • The APT framework is intended to ensure fair‑market‑value for owner‑linked commercial deals.
  • Reports indicate the settlement could clear the way for a long‑term Etihad Airways sponsorship.
  • A separate Premier League case alleging more than 100 financial breaches by City remains unresolved.
